Easy Asian Beef & Vegetable Skewers Recipe Is a Satisfying, Healthy Meal by Sarah Amona

Even when eating a healthy diet, you can have lean, red meat in moderation. This easy Asian beef and vegetable skewers recipe is made with sirloin steak and colorful, healthy peppers. So satisfying and delicious!
Serve this easy beef recipe with your favorite healthy side dishes and dipping sauce. This recipe makes two servings but can easily be doubled or tripled.
Cuisine: Asian / American
Prep Time: 24 hours to marinate
Cook Time: 10 to 20 minutes
Total Time: 20 minutes plus 24 hours to marinate
Servings: 2
Ingredients
Steak
- 14 ounces beef sirloin steak, cut into 1-inch pieces
Marinade
- 1/4 cup lite soy sauce
- 1 teaspoon beef bouillon granules
- 1/4 cup water
- 1/2 teaspoon garlic powder
- 1/2 teaspoon ground ginger
- 1/4 teaspoon black pepper
- 2 teaspoons sesame seeds (optional)
Vegetables
- 3 cups green, yellow or red peppers, cut into 1-inch pieces
Here's how to make it:
- Combine ingredients for marinade in a small bowl. Marinate meat overnight in a large zipper bag in the marinade. Add the vegetables to marinade an hour before cooking.
- Discard marinade and assemble meat and veggies on skewers. Put the skewers of meat and veggies on the grill and cook until desired doneness.
